Contabo's "up to" language lets them stuff ten subscribers on one PON segment
PON is fiber-to-the-home tech, not datacenter. Contabo's not running GPON in their St. Louis cage. The bottleneck is upstream transit commit, not passive optical splitting.
That said, the economics rhyme. Oversubscription ratios work the same whether it's a 10G wave or a 2.5G PON split.

I run ARM in Seoul, power is everything here. My OVHcloud Singapore instance draws 8W and pushes steady 85 Mbps on a 100 contract. The Vultr Seoul pop? Same wattage, same throughput. Both publish enough about their upstream to let me verify — OVHcloud status: https://status.ovhcloud.com
Contabo's Tokyo pop should be close, but their peering to Korean carriers is thin. I tested from a friend's line in Busan: 34 Mbps on 100, routed through NTT every time. Geography without local peering is just expensive latency.
